Abstract

fetched live from OpenAlex

Innovation policy instruments in OECD countries are developed from different streams of policies related to the suppliers and the users of knowledge. They are also integrated into different levels of implementation (supranational, national, regional and local). Such complexity leads policy actors and stakeholders to experience a lack of coordination in their innovation efforts. This paper, based on a broad cross-country analysis of 844 innovation policy instruments implemented in 27 OECD countries, aims to contribute to the advancement of knowledge on this issue by: 1 validating a conceptual framework as a tool of policy instrument coordination 2 conducting an innovation policy instrument framework based both on the conceptual framework and a on diversity of instruments. The innovation policy instrument framework has been devised to be used as a roadmap to link innovation policy instruments and innovation functions.
